Introduction to Madhappy Clothing

Madhappy Clothing is more than a streetwear brand—it's a cultural movement. Founded in 2017 by Peiman Raf and Noah Raf, along with Mason Spector and Joshua Sitt, the Los Angeles-based label quickly rose to prominence for its distinctive blend of elevated basics and meaningful messaging centered around mental health awareness. From high-quality hoodies and graphic tees to collaborative capsule collections, Madhappy has cultivated a loyal following among Gen Z and Millennials who care not only about fashion but also about emotional well-being.

The Vision Behind Madhappy

At the core of Madhappy’s mission is a strong commitment to breaking the stigma surrounding mental health. Unlike traditional streetwear labels focused solely on aesthetics or hype, Madhappy’s narrative is deeply rooted in optimism, vulnerability, and inclusivity. The brand name itself is a juxtaposition—a reflection of life’s emotional duality. Through fashion, Madhappy encourages open conversations around emotional wellness.

The company also launched The Madhappy Foundation, a non-profit that supports mental health initiatives through research, direct funding, and accessible resources. Every purchase contributes to this larger mission, allowing customers to wear their values literally on their sleeves.

Premium Craftsmanship and Elevated Streetwear

Madhappy Clothing is known for exceptional quality and timeless silhouettes. Their collections often feature:

  • Ultra-soft fleece hoodies with oversized fits

  • Garment-dyed T-shirts with vintage aesthetics

  • Relaxed-fit sweatpants and shorts

  • Embroidered logos and screen-printed artwork

The label pays meticulous attention to fabric quality, dye processes, and stitching, resulting in pieces that feel as premium as they look. With a price point higher than average streetwear brands, Madhappy positions itself in the luxury streetwear segment, competing with the likes of Fear of God Essentials, Aimé Leon Dore, and Rhude.

Global Retail Presence and Flagship Stores

While Madhappy initially gained traction through online-exclusive drops, the brand has since expanded into brick-and-mortar retail experiences. Their pop-up stores in New York, Los Angeles, Aspen, and Miami have served not just as shopping destinations but as community spaces. These locations often host mental health panels, live performances, and art installations—solidifying Madhappy’s dedication to building real-world connections.

The Madhappy Foundation: Mental Health in Focus

What truly sets Madhappy apart is its non-profit foundation, established to drive mental health research, advocacy, and accessibility. A portion of all sales directly funds initiatives such as:

  • Free mental health screenings

  • Therapy scholarships

  • Educational content creation

  • Grants to mental health startups and organizations

The Foundation’s presence makes Madhappy not just a fashion label but a social impact brand, earning credibility and loyalty from socially conscious consumers.
